Weiz to the Alps: 7-10 day circuit

From Weiz, head towards the famous Grossglockner road, a scenic excursion of less than 50 km featuring 36 spectacular turns. This exceptional road offers ideal pull-offs to park and admire the alpine landscapes (paid access, about €43 per day). Wild camping is prohibited here, but the area has more than twenty excellent campsites. Return to Weiz while exploring picturesque villages and crystal-clear lakes in Styria, completing an immersive loop between raw nature and Austrian charm.

Seasonality of rates around Weiz

From Weiz, camping and campervan site rates rise sharply in July-August in very touristy regions like Salzburg, Innsbruck, or the Salzkammergut, which corresponds to the Austrian high season. By staying based in Weiz at the beginning or end of the season, it is often possible to find softer prices in Styria's campsites while making loops to Graz or Mariazell for the day or for a few nights.

From Weiz, the low season generally extends from November to March, excluding the Christmas and New Year periods when the markets in Graz, Vienna, or Salzburg drive prices up. A campervan trip from Weiz in spring or early autumn often allows for interesting intermediate rates in campsites near Bad Radkersburg, the Loipersdorf thermal baths, or the lakes of Carinthia, all while enjoying still mild weather.

Driving and regulations around Weiz

From Weiz, on the B72 towards Graz, campervans under 3.5 tons are subject to the same speed limits as private cars, with 50 km/h in built-up areas like in the center of Weiz, 100 km/h outside built-up areas towards Gleisdorf, and 130 km/h on the A2 and S6 highways leading to Vienna or Leoben.

To use the A2 highway from the Graz-Ost highway junction coming from Weiz, you need to buy a vignette if your campervan is below 3.5 tons, while heavier vehicles leaving Weiz to cross all of Styria towards Linz or Salzburg must use the GO-Box toll system, with a rate depending notably on the number of axles and the emissions class.

Sleeping in a campervan and connecting around Weiz

From Weiz, it is recommended to favor official campsites or dedicated areas, as wild camping is generally prohibited in Austria and controlled throughout the Styria region, including in nearby valleys like Raabklamm and on the heights leading to Almenland and Fladnitz an der Teichalm.

For the night, many van travelers leave Weiz for campsites equipped with electric charging stations and waste water disposal near Graz, the thermal region of Bad Waltersdorf, or along the Mur valley, which allows for easy connections, refilling water, and respecting local rules without risking a fine.

Local tips and safety from Weiz

From Weiz, it is wise to inquire with the Weiz town hall or the Graz tourist office before spending the night in an isolated parking lot, as in Styria some municipalities prohibit overnight parking for campervans outside campsites, especially near very frequented lakes like Stubenbergsee or in mountain areas towards Hochschwab.

When driving between Weiz, Gleisdorf, and Graz, it is advisable to adapt your driving to the hilly and sometimes narrow roads, to strictly observe the speed limits in the small villages of Almenland, and to only take short night rest breaks in roadside parking lots, as these stops are tolerated for safety but should not turn into camping with wedges, awnings, or deployed furniture.
